Best time to go to Orlando

The best time to visit Orlando is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with moderate r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January60.6°F (15.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
February64.4°F (18.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
March67.6°F (19.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
April72.7°F (22.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
May77.2°F (25.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
June81.1°F (27.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July82.4°F (28.0°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August82.6°F (28.1°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
September80.4°F (26.9°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
October75.2°F (24.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
November68.5°F (20.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
December64.4°F (18.0°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High

Orlando Essential Information

Language
English
Currency
U.S dollars
Closest Airport
Orlando Intl. Airport (MCO)
Population
270,900
Max Temp Winter
21ºC
Max Temp Summer
32ºC
Top Sights
Universal Orlando Resort, The Wizarding World of Harry Potter™ and Aquatica

Stay near popular Orlando attractions

A large blue globe with the word "UNIVERSAL" in gold letters.

Universal Studios Florida

9.4/10 (44,682 reviews)
Step into film magic at Universal Studios Florida, where blockbuster films come to life through immersive rides. Experience the Wizarding World of Harry Potter or battle alongside Transformers in thrilling adventures.

Magic Kingdom® Park

9.2/10 (17,587 reviews)
Magic Kingdom's iconic Cinderella Castle anchors six themed lands with classic Disney attractions. Arrive early for Space Mountain and "It's a Small World" before watching the spectacular fireworks display.

Epcot®

9.2/10 (13,750 reviews)
Epcot blends futuristic innovation with pavilions from 11 countries for a global journey. Experience thrilling rides like Test Track or enjoy authentic cuisine during seasonal festivals around World Showcase Lagoon.

Orange County Convention Center

8.8/10 (9,272 reviews)
America's second-largest convention centre hosts over 200 major events annually in Orlando's tourism district. Explore its state-of-the-art facilities and enjoy nearby International Drive's dining and entertainment.

Do I need a visa for my Orlando holiday?
Visa requirements for Orlando vary based on your nationality and the reason for your visit. It's wise to check official government websites to determine if you need a visa for your holiday. They'll also give you the most up-to-date information, including details about application procedures and any supporting documentation that might be necessary. Research your visa requirements in advance to ensure a hassle-free travel experience. Also check to see that your passport is valid for a further six months from your return date.
